How to Choose a VDR Provider

Whether you’re facilitating an M&A transaction, collaborating with partners outside your firewall or sharing confidential data with clients, a virtual data room (VDR) is a critical tool for securely managing and sharing this information. But not all VDRs are created equally. The wrong VDR may expose your company to increased security risks and costs. Thankfully, there’s a way to determine which VDR providers are worth your business.

As you’re shopping for a VDR, start by reading online reviews and checking out their websites. You can talk to a representative by phone or live chat to see how they respond and answer questions.

When looking at a provider, make sure they offer a wide variety of features to meet your specific needs. Included in this are features for document security, collaboration and file management. Also, look for providers that offer two-factor verification to prevent password robbery as well as advanced security methods like dynamic watermarks or data encryption.

A modern VDR is one that leverages new business models and technology innovations like software-as-a-service delivery. This allows for a competitive pricing without compromising control and security.

While traditional VDRs are often focused on M&A deals, a modern VDR is available to any team or business that requires high levels of collaboration and security. Examples include law companies, banks and mortgage brokers. Venture capital firms, hedge funds and private equity are also examples.
